- [ ] Step 7: Archive cold storage buckets (Glacierline tier). Confirm both ceremony witnesses are present, verify bucket manifests match the Oxbow ledger, then seal the archive key shares. Plugin authors may observe but not handle shares. Once sealed, the archive index itself is encrypted and can only be reopened with the passphrase below.

vault phrase of badup-hahig = tamael-aldael-kelmir-istael-fenok-istwyn-tamius-jorath-oliion

## Deployment: Replacing the Legacy Job Queue

We are migrating from the homegrown Chorework queue to Relayloom. Both systems run in parallel during rollout; Relayloom handles new job types while Chorework drains existing ones. New team members should deploy the shadow-mode worker first and compare completion metrics for at least one day. The shadow worker must be launched with the following configuration values.

service settings:
[casax]
port = 6379
team = rusir
host = casax.zemvarhq.corp
region = outer-4
access_code = ac_9808ce
timeout_ms = 1500

## UI Snapshot Store

Heads up, reviewer: the Frostpane component snapshots aren't kept in git — they were bloating the repo, so we moved them to a dedicated store. Each CI run diffs rendered output against the stored baseline and flags drift. Nothing sensitive lives in snapshots, just serialized markup. The baseline database is accessed using the following.

replica DSN, kajep-yahag: mssql://praok_svc:iF@db-8d68.plorvaio.local:5432/eliion